1st International Workshop on Bismuth-Containing Semiconductors
The first International Workshop on Bismuth-Containing Semiconductors was held from July 14-16, 2010 at the University of Michigan. The goal of the workshop was to bring together experimentalists and theoreticians who study Bi-containing materials for optoelectronics and thermoelectrics. The workshop was organized by The Michigan Center for Theoretical Physics and Materials World Network on III-V Bismide Materials for IR and Mid IR Semiconductors sponsored by the National Science Foundation.
2nd International Workshop on Bismuth-Containing Semiconductors
The second International Workshop on Bismuth-Containing Semiconductors takes place from July 18-20, 2011 at University of Surrey. The workshop is being organised by Prof. Stephen Sweeney (University of Surrey), and aims to build on the success of the first workshop, to establish a regular forum for exchange of information and latest results of this novel material system. All talks will be brief with plenty of time set aside for discussion. Specific topics include:
Bismide growth and bismuth incorporation strategies
Structural, electrical, and optical characterization
Theoretical studies of bismide semiconductor properties and device physics
Device fabrication and performance
